Genetic Drift

Random change in allele frequencies in a population over time.

Genetic Load

The frequency of deleterious alleles that have accumulated in a population.

Genetic Bottleneck

The phenomenon in which a population lineage shrinks to a small size for a period, causing that population to lose genetic variation.

Fixation

The process by which an allele’s frequency reaches 100% in a population.

Directional Selection

A form of selection that drives the allele frequency in one direction, removing genetic variation.

Neutral Alleles

Alleles that have no selective advantage or disadvantage affecting their frequency.

Polymorphic Locus

A genetic locus with two or more alleles present in a population.
